### Deploy step 6: ORM shim cutover

Heads-up for the sync: this week we flip Marrowdb reads from the old HandRolled ORM to the new Lattice layer. The shim keeps write paths untouched, so rollback is just a flag toggle. Watch query latency on the dashboards for the first hour — the legacy joins were doing some truly cursed things. Once the canary looks clean, sign and push the release manifest. Use this deploy key.

release key, fajef-kajeg: bky19_LdLu6Ne6FLi8he2c24d

## Deployment

Scrubline is the service that strips EXIF data from uploaded images before they reach storage. Deploys go through the standard pipeline; new team members should deploy to the sandbox tier first and verify a test image loses its GPS tags. The sandbox tier uses the configuration values below.

service settings:
[ulair]
team = praath
access_code = ac_06d704
owner = wenix.ulair
host = ulair.qirvancorp.corp
port = 9200
peer = sorys.nelvronet.internal
salt = 2668132c
pin = 9140

## Changelog — Textgrove v4.2

Heads up, new folks: we changed the default encoding detection for uploaded text files. Previously Textgrove assumed Latin-1 whenever the sniffer wasn't confident, which mangled a surprising number of Polish and Turkish uploads. Now we fall back to UTF-8 with strict validation, and files that fail get quarantined instead of silently garbled. If you're debugging an old ticket, check whether it predates this change. The defaults now in effect on the ingest service are as follows.

config for yajep-tafof:
[rusath]
team = julmir
access_code = ac_fe37fd
host = rusath.novactech.test
port = 8000
owner = pelmir.weneth
peer = oliwyn.olvarqdyn.internal